THE local committee of the Portadown Cancer Research UK group has raised a total of £8,373.75 during 2012, it announced at its annual general meeting on Monday.

The money was raised through events such as quiz nights, street and shop collections, a ladies gourmet evening, a church concert, a golfing event, a sponsored kayaking event and even a collection at a motorcycle race!

Committee chairperson, Liz Cushnie, thanked her small but enthusiastic committee for all their hard work over the year. She also thanked friends and family for their continued assistance.

She especially paid tribute to the people of Portadown for their continued support and all the local businesses who have assisted and sponsored events over the year with particular thanks to The Yellow Door, Tesco, Inner Wheel, Armagh Road Presbyterian church and the in memoriam donations forwarded in lieu of flowers.

Cancer Research UK is the world’s leading charity dedicated to beating cancer through research. Millions of lives have been saved by discovering new ways to prevent, diagnose and treat cancer, and survival has doubled over the past 40 years.

They fund research into more than 200 types of cancer and with hard-working scientists here in N.I. and the UK they’re the single largest funder of Cancer Research. From the most common – such as breast, bowel, lung and prostate cancers – to rare types of tumour and children’s cancers, they support groundbreaking science that benefits everyone.
